امتیاز موضوع:
  • 0 رأی - میانگین امتیازات: 0
  • 1
  • 2
  • 3
  • 4
  • 5
طریقه وصل کردن کلید به میکرو
نویسنده پیام
mehdisb آفلاین
تازه وارد

ارسال‌ها: 1
موضوع‌ها: 1
تاریخ عضویت: آذر ۱۳۹۳

تشکرها : 0
( 1 تشکر در 1 ارسال )
ارسال: #1
طریقه وصل کردن کلید به میکرو
سلام دوستان عزیز
من میخوام یک کلید فشاری به میکرو وصل کنم و زمانی که کلید زده میشود در حد چند صدم ثانیه یک پایه از میکرو یک بدهد و بعدش دوباره صفرشود ولی کلید همچنان فشرده یاشد و برای چند دقیقه کلید فشرده است و دوباره وقتی کلید زده میشود یک پالس دیگه خارج کند و دوباره پایه خزوجی صفرشود وهمچنان دکمه فشرده می باشد با تشکر
(آخرین ویرایش در این ارسال: ۱۸-آذر-۱۳۹۳, ۰۸:۱۸:۵۰، توسط behzady.)
۱۵-آذر-۱۳۹۳, ۰۰:۱۳:۵۶
ارسال‌ها
پاسخ
تشکر شده توسط : ddd-zzz
kimiafars آفلاین
کاربر با تجربه
****

ارسال‌ها: 819
موضوع‌ها: 71
تاریخ عضویت: فروردین ۱۳۸۶

تشکرها : 663
( 1139 تشکر در 512 ارسال )
ارسال: #2
RE: طریقه وصل کردن کلید به میکرو
سلام ایا با دستور دیبانس و یک شرط کارت راه می افته برات بنویسم

تولید دیمر قناری و دستگاههای کنترل سالن هیدروپونیک و اکواپونیک(انبردست)anbordast.ir[url=anbordast.ir][/url]
۱۶-آذر-۱۳۹۳, ۰۷:۰۵:۵۷
ارسال‌ها
پاسخ
تشکر شده توسط : رسول, hadikh73
sadegh1rezaei آفلاین
كاربر تک ستاره
*

ارسال‌ها: 40
موضوع‌ها: 9
تاریخ عضویت: مرداد ۱۳۹۳

تشکرها : 46
( 33 تشکر در 17 ارسال )
ارسال: #3
RE: طریقه وصل کردن کلید به میکرو
ما که نفهمیدیم که شما چه فرمودید ولی این مدار شاید بکارت بیاد
http://www.iranled.com/forum/attachment.php?aid=12624
حالا هر جا که دوست داشتی یه پورت برای چند صدم ثانیه یک باشد زیر
If A > 10 And A < 100 Then
می تونی بنویسی
portx=1
waitms 10
portx=0
و ادامه برنامه ات
۱۶-آذر-۱۳۹۳, ۱۵:۵۹:۵۹
ارسال‌ها
پاسخ
تشکر شده توسط : رسول, a.mehran, kimiafars, vigraz
parsegade آفلاین
در حال پیشرفت
***

ارسال‌ها: 251
موضوع‌ها: 47
تاریخ عضویت: آبان ۱۳۸۸

تشکرها : 162
( 62 تشکر در 44 ارسال )
ارسال: #4
RE: طریقه وصل کردن کلید به میکرو
این برنامه رو من واسه یه مداری نوشته بودم.اگه کلید رو لحظه ای میزدی یکی از پورتها یک میشد(به صورت لحظه ای)اگه کلید رو نگه میداشتی پایه دیگه میکرو به صورت لحظه ای روشن میشد
کد:
$regfile = "m8def.dat"
$crystal = 8000000
Config Pind.0 = Output
Config Pind.5 = Output
Config Pinc.4 = Input
Dim A As Long , B As Word
A = 0
B = 0


Do

If Pinc.4 = 1 Then
Waitms 100
Goto Q

End If
Goto Halghe

Q:

Do
A = A + 1
Waitms 20
Loop Until Pinc.4 = 0

If A <= 30 Then
Toggle Portd.0
Waitms 500
Reset Pind.5

Goto Halghe
End If

If A > 30 Then
Toggle Portd.5
Waitms 500
Reset Pind.0

Goto Halghe
End If

Halghe:

Waitms 500

Reset Portd.0
Reset Portd.5

A = 0
Loop
۱۷-آذر-۱۳۹۳, ۲۲:۴۰:۲۸
ارسال‌ها
پاسخ
تشکر شده توسط : Ambassador, omid_phoenix


موضوعات مرتبط با این موضوع...
موضوع نویسنده پاسخ بازدید آخرین ارسال
  مشکل در پاک کردن برنامه میکرو Salam7 1 398 ۲۹-بهمن-۱۴۰۰, ۲۲:۵۰:۴۴
آخرین ارسال: 1نفر
  [فوری] ایجاد موج مربعی با دو کلید و نماش فرکانس در ال سی دی mamadr 0 2,041 ۰۹-تير-۱۳۹۶, ۱۶:۲۰:۲۹
آخرین ارسال: mamadr
  هنگ کردن میکرو در ارتباط سریال nex 1 2,890 ۰۴-آبان-۱۳۹۵, ۲۰:۵۶:۵۹
آخرین ارسال: علی محد شریفی
  تست میکرو saber.k 10 14,048 ۰۹-شهریور-۱۳۹۵, ۰۲:۰۹:۲۷
آخرین ارسال: yadulla fazel
  کار نکردن میکرو بعد از پروگرام کردن آن namesis 26 21,412 ۲۹-اردیبهشت-۱۳۹۵, ۲۳:۲۹:۴۸
آخرین ارسال: behzadtar
  با میکرو یک کلید 220 رو کنترل کنیم saeidjan 7 13,676 ۱۹-بهمن-۱۳۹۴, ۱۰:۵۴:۱۵
آخرین ارسال: sharin
  اتصالات برای روشن کردن میکرو poiut 1 2,147 ۱۸-آذر-۱۳۹۴, ۱۷:۵۵:۲۹
آخرین ارسال: sharin
  کمک در پروگرام کردن میکرو sara90 24 19,183 ۲۴-مرداد-۱۳۹۴, ۱۰:۳۷:۲۲
آخرین ارسال: محمد صادق
  درایو کردن ماسفت با میکرو armin_gera 9 9,201 ۱۷-تير-۱۳۹۴, ۱۶:۲۸:۰۹
آخرین ارسال: armin_gera
  کمک برای وصل کلید و پرش به برنامه های مختلف sinohe 8 5,475 ۱۶-آبان-۱۳۹۳, ۱۶:۲۰:۱۱
آخرین ارسال: sadegh1rezaei

پرش به انجمن:


کاربرانِ درحال بازدید از این موضوع: 1 مهمان

صفحه‌ی تماس | IranVig | بازگشت به بالا | | بایگانی | پیوند سایتی RSS